OSDN Git Service

Snap for 4434599 from 24ab40f70bb5d504c0c33bfe25ff43a67bbfd91a to pi-release
authorandroid-build-team Robot <android-build-team-robot@google.com>
Sun, 5 Nov 2017 07:38:58 +0000 (07:38 +0000)
committerandroid-build-team Robot <android-build-team-robot@google.com>
Sun, 5 Nov 2017 07:38:58 +0000 (07:38 +0000)
Change-Id: Iabf061b0dcfd75b22a9fceccfb54419764904e8e

jni/Android.mk
jni_jpegstream/Android.mk

index 32c7163..55bb205 100644 (file)
@@ -1,9 +1,16 @@
 LOCAL_PATH:= $(call my-dir)
 
+Gallery2_jni_cflags := \
+    -Wall -Wextra -Werror \
+    -Wno-error=constant-conversion \
+    -Wno-unused-parameter \
+
+# to fix implicit conversion from 'int' to 'char', (255 to -1, 128 to -128)
+
 include $(CLEAR_VARS)
 
-LOCAL_CFLAGS += -DEGL_EGLEXT_PROTOTYPES -Wno-unused-parameter
-LOCAL_CFLAGS += -Wall -Wextra
+LOCAL_CFLAGS += -DEGL_EGLEXT_PROTOTYPES
+LOCAL_CFLAGS += $(Gallery2_jni_cflags)
 
 LOCAL_SRC_FILES := jni_egl_fence.cpp
 
@@ -45,8 +52,8 @@ LOCAL_SRC_FILES := filters/gradient.c \
                    filters/tinyplanet.cc \
                    filters/kmeans.cc
 
-LOCAL_CFLAGS    += -ffast-math -O3 -funroll-loops -Wno-unused-parameter
-LOCAL_CFLAGS += -Wall -Wextra
+LOCAL_CFLAGS += -ffast-math -O3 -funroll-loops
+LOCAL_CFLAGS += $(Gallery2_jni_cflags)
 LOCAL_LDLIBS := -llog -ljnigraphics
 LOCAL_ARM_MODE := arm
 
index f3a631d..cac2a7b 100644 (file)
@@ -17,7 +17,7 @@ LOCAL_SDK_VERSION   := 17
 LOCAL_ARM_MODE := arm
 
 LOCAL_CFLAGS    += -ffast-math -O3 -funroll-loops
-LOCAL_CFLAGS += -Wall -Wextra
+LOCAL_CFLAGS += -Wall -Wextra -Werror
 LOCAL_LDLIBS := -llog
 
 LOCAL_CPP_EXTENSION := .cpp